PALMER — The Alaska State Fair is currently looking for candidates who are interested in serving on the board of directors.
According to a recent press release, the ASF board consists of seven members who set policies for the private, nonprofit organization.
Current board members include President John Harkey, Vice President Jason Ortiz, secretary Cody Beus, treasurer Aryne Randall, Director Jon-Marc Petersen, Director Carol Kenley, and Director William Fischer, Director.
Current 2023 annual and lifetime (those who joined before March 18, 2024) ASF members will vote to fill one open board seat who will serve a three-year term.
Incumbent board secretary Cody Beus is up for re-election.
A new Director will be elected at the Fair’s annual meeting which is set for Wednesday, May 15 at 7 p.m.
The board of directors works to ensure that the Fair operates within the law; remains aware of the enjoyment, education, comfort, and safety of its customers, and acts with its best interest in all circumstances.
The press release indicated that the election committee is looking for "individuals who can envision the Fair as a gathering place for all Alaskans by encompassing the past, present, and future, and individuals who can make the full commitment of time and self-discipline it takes to set policy."
Candidates are required to be Alaskan residents who are at least 18 years old and members of the Alaska State Fair (either a lifetime member or an annual member in the current year).
Candidates must also not have been employed by the Fair in a year span, not be an immediate family member of a Fair employee, or someone who resides with a Fair employee.
